• 技术文章 >Java >java教程

    java中tostring方法的作用是什么

    coldplay.xixicoldplay.xixi2020-08-01 16:17:33原创267

    java中tostring方法的作用是会返回一个【以文本方式表示】此对象的字符串,结果是一个简明但易于读懂的信息表达式。

    java中tostring方法的作用是

    toString方法会返回一个“以文本方式表示”此对象的字符串。结果是一个简明但易于读懂的信息表达式。建议所有子类都重写此方法。

    Object类是toString方法返回一个字符串,该字符串由类名(对象是该类的一个实例)、at标记符“@”和此对象哈希码的无符号十六进制表示组成。换句话说,该方法返回一个字符串,它的值等于:

    getClass().getName()+'@'+Integer.toHexString(hashCode());

    返回:该对象的字符串表示形式

    因为它是Object里面已经有了的方法,而所有类都是继承Object,所以“所有对象都有这个方法”;

    它通常只是为了方便输出,比如System.out.println(xx),括号里面的“xx”如果不是String类型的话,就自动调用xx的toString()方法;

    总而言之,它只是sun公司开发java的时候为了方便所有类的字符串操作而特意加入的一个方法。

    f1b598857b0bbd357a5e073a9ede9ff.png

    扩展资料

    tostring的使用示例
    publicclassOrc
    {
    publicstaticclassA
    {
    publicStringtoString()
    {
    return"thisisA";
    }
    }
    publicstaticvoidmain(String[]args)
    {
    Aobj=newA();
    System.out.println(obj);
    }
    }

    相关学习推荐:Java视频教程

    以上就是java中tostring方法的作用是什么的详细内容,更多请关注php中文网其它相关文章!

    本文原创发布php中文网,转载请注明出处,感谢您的尊重!
    专题推荐:java tostring方法
    上一篇:Java中switch case 语句问题 下一篇:没有了
    第12期线上周末培训班

    相关文章推荐

    • JavaScript对象序列化、toString()与valueOf()的用法介绍• PHP中 __toString()方法详解• java中toString()方法有什么用法• java中tostring方法怎么用• java中的toString方法如何使用

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网